Average Veterinary Technologists and Technicians Salary in Portland-South Portland, ME

Veterinary Technologists and Technicians in Portland-South Portland, ME, earn an impressive average annual salary of $50,450. This figure significantly surpasses the national average of $45,970, indicating a strong local demand and potentially higher cost of operations or specialized services in the region that drive compensation upwards.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 440 employees in the Portland-South Portland, ME area with a job density of 1.54 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
